What I do

By day I am the Learning Officer for the Bristol Dinosaur Project, University of Bristol and in my own time I work on a huge variety of freelance, nature-related opportunities.

 

Broadcasting

Reporter for BBC Radio 4’s 'Saving Species'

Have a weekly (Thursdays) wildlife slot on Faye Dicker's show at 5.45am on BBC Radio Bristol, Somerset, Gloucestershire and Wiltshire; give bi-monthly newspaper reviews for BBC Radio Bristol's Breakfast show with Steve Le Fevre.

Extensive contributions to BBC Autumnwatch, BBC Autumnwatch Unsprung, BBC Radio Bristol, BBC Points West and Inside Out West.

 

Magazine writing and copy editing

Write features for magazines/journals eg BBC Wildlife, BBC Countryfile, British Birds and Birdwatch. Copy edit for journal papers, PhD theses and books.

 

Bird ID training

Deliver training courses and presentations from bird song identification to the secret lives of our garden birds.

 

Wildlife cruises

Provide wildlife commentary on Bristol Ferry boats, Bristol and RSPB Avocet cruises, Devon.

 

Wildlife Consulting

Wildlife consultant for natural history television companies eg BBC Natural History Unit and Tigress Productions (for the BBC One Show).

Complete bird surveys for the University of Bristol and British Trust for Ornithology (BTO).

 

Tour Leading

Wildlife tour leader for Naturetrek: Leading nature tours in February and May on the Somerset Levels; enabling people to spot whales and dolphins in the Azores and Monterey Bay, California; and showing people wolves and bustards in Spain.

 

Diverse experience

Take part in relevant activities/training eg scuba diving, wildlife photography, bird and bat ringing, finding dormice, tagging hares, identifying dragonflies and studying peregrine falcons.
